ASP会话管理:优化用户状态保持与跟踪策略
|
ASP(Active Server Pages)会话管理是Web开发中至关重要的部分,它确保用户在不同页面请求之间能够保持状态。会话管理的核心在于如何有效存储和追踪用户的交互信息。
AI绘图,仅供参考 在ASP中,会话数据通常通过Session对象进行管理。当用户首次访问网站时,服务器会为该用户创建一个唯一的会话ID,并将其存储在客户端的Cookie中。这样,每次用户发送请求时,服务器都能识别出对应会话,从而恢复之前的状态。 为了提高性能和安全性,合理设置会话超时时间非常重要。过长的超时可能导致资源浪费,而过短则会影响用户体验。开发人员应根据应用的实际需求调整超时参数,确保平衡。 另一方面,会话数据的存储方式也值得优化。除了默认的内存存储,还可以考虑使用数据库或分布式缓存来保存会话信息,特别是在多服务器环境中,这种方式能提升系统的可扩展性和稳定性。 随着Web技术的发展,ASP逐渐被更现代的框架取代,但理解其会话管理机制仍然有助于掌握状态保持的基本原理。良好的会话策略不仅能提升用户体验,还能增强应用程序的安全性与效率。 (编辑:草根网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330554号